Providing Software Support for Reconfigurable Networks

Workload patterns in Data Center Networks (DCNs) vary by time. As such, deployment of reconfigurable topologies to handle these varying workloads is a promising approach. Network efficiency can be improved by tailoring the network topology to the workload, which can reduce the average path length thus supporting more flows simultaneously. However, without proper software support, physically altering a network is very disruptive to active flows and results in significant periods of poor network utilization. We propose a software support framework for reconfigurable networks that reduces the amount of disruption to existing flows during topology reconfiguration. This framework deconstructs the planned topology changes (link additions and removals) into a series of smaller steps where each step only affects a small fraction of existing flows. It also proactively reroutes flows before and after each step to avoid packet losses due to topology reconfiguration and allow existing flows to take advantage of newly added links. We evaluate our prototype using iperf and find that without software support, there is a window during which new links may be under-utilized or not used at all due to congestive collapse. In contrast, our prototype system is able to ensure those links remain usable, and quickly increase overall network efficiency after the reconfiguration.
